This is a Request for information. This is not a solicitation for a procurement contract, nor should this announcement be construed as implying any future solicitation by USTRANSCOM or any other federal government agency in this area.
United States Transportation Command (USTRANSCOM) is seeking non-federal partners (“Collaborators”) in industry and/or academia to consider for entry into Cooperative Research and Development Agreements (CRADAs) with the federal government, as described in 15 USC 3710a, to produce study results illustrating the uses, limitations, and delivered value of emerging technology for USTRANSCOM. These studies will produce findings on technical and operational maturity, uses, economics, underlying technologies, and risks/benefits of emerging MASS systems in support of Department of War (DoW) materiel distribution needs across global supply chains.
